What is Railroad Settlement AML?
Railroad Settlement AML refers to a legal and financial mechanism targeted at attending to the ecological effect of deserted mines, especially those that have caused acid mine drain (AMD). Acid mine drainage occurs when sulfide minerals in exposed rock surfaces react with water and air, producing sulfuric acid. This acidic overflow can infect neighboring water bodies, harming marine ecosystems and impacting drinking water sources.
